[Top 5] Kenshi Best Farm Base Locations

So you want to start a farm in Kenshi…


Food is scarce in Kenshi and there are two ways of getting food - stealing it from already half-starved bandits or starting your farm in which you can grow your wheat, rice, vegetables, and even cactuses. If you want more nutrition, you can combine those various foods into stuff like Dustwiches, Gohan, Meatcubes plus other things. 

Of course, each zone has different fertility and we’re gonna discuss the best zones for farming - let’s begin with:

5. Okran’s Pride

Not so friendly towards non-humans.

Okran’s Pride, as you all probably know, is the land of the Holy Nation, which means that they’re gonna look down upon you if you happen to be a Shek and god forbid, a Skeleton. It’s advisable to hide somewhere, far from the roads, and start your little farm in your little outpost. These lands are perfect for growing wheat and bread is known for keeping you satied. Try not to get enslaved, though!

Why this zone is awesome for farming:

  •  Excellent wheat farming speed
  •  Especially great if you’re a human

4. The Swamp

Welcome to the rice fields, mothafu-

The Swamp is known for not very friendly people and bandits that will occasionally raid your outpost. Don’t worry too much about them though, they’re weak and The Swamp is an excellent place for rice farming that you can combine with vegetables, which will give you Gohan. Hooray!

Fertility is out of the roof in this zone and the farming speed should be super-duper fast!

Why this zone is awesome for farming:

  •  Rice
  •  Allows you to farm vegetables, that you can turn into Gohan if mixed with rice

3. Border Zone

A contested territory.

What can you grow here? Wheat and cactuses. You can make dustwiches from those and enjoy a good ol’ cactus sandwich - disgusting, but nutritious. And cactuses grow like crazy in deserts so you will never run out of dustwiches in the Border Zone. Have fun!

Why this zone is great for farming:

  •  Hell ton of bread and cactuses if you decide to farm here
  •  No river raptors that will eat your crops
  •  Enemies ain’t too tough up in there

2. Sinkuun

The house of the downtrodden.

Sinkuun is the zone of rebel farmers, peasants, and outlaws. These guys escaped The Great Desert city in search of a better life, where they can avoid persecution from the Samurais. They’re gonna befriend you if you bring them one of the nobles and not hassle your outpost, but even if they do, they’re pretty weak and they’ll scatter like rats if they try anything. 

You can farm here bread and cactuses, but some areas contain ground that’s suitable for vegetables. Good luck!

Why this zone is great:

  •  100% arid, 10% green
  •  There are also some hive villages with farming supplies
  •  Also some nomads roaming nearby

1. Leviathan Coast

No cannibals here.

This area is excellent for farming - the only enemies that you have to worry about are the stupid Beak Things, they are easy to kill and serve as a great source of meat - the same thing applies to the roaming Bonedogs and Garrus. 

So, what can you farm on this soil? Wheat, cactuses, vegetables, and plenty of meat, that you can combine into food cubes that restore 75 nutrition. If you’d rather be a hermit and stay inside of your comfortable outpost all day, you can satisfy yourself with the delicious dustwiches!

Why this zone is great for farming:

  •  100% green fertility
  •  50% arid fertility
  •  A lot of roaming Garrus, Beak Things, and Bonedogs
